We don't yet know the names, but the first is a frog with a stick. Does it look like a Pokémon? No, it's a frog with a stick.The second looks like an ostrich with some fancy head plumage. Does it look like a Pokémon? It kind of looks like Espathra, at least in that it's also inspired by an ostrich.
The third is a sort of dog with long ears levitating like a Buddhist monk. Does it look like a Pokémon? Nothing specific. The last is a cute green little guy with a mushroom on its head. Does it look like a Pokémon? There's perhaps a certain Quagsire look if you squint.In short, these new Pals don't seem particularly Pokémon-esque, though they still fit with the aesthetic of the game.
